Cabane de la Rama
Cabane de la Rama is a building in Les Orres, Arrondissement of Gap, Provence-Alpes-Côte d’Azur and has an elevation of 1,938 metres. Cabane de la Rama is situated nearby to the church Chapelle Saint-Pierre, as well as near the peak Pointe de Pémian.Places of Interest Nearby

Col du Parpaillon
Mountain saddle
The Col du Parpaillon is a pass in the Cottian Alps of southern France in the Parpaillon massif that can not be passed anymore with vehicles as the tunnel was blocked by a landslide on 12 July 2024. Col du Parpaillon is situated 3 km northeast of Cabane de la Rama.

Les Orres
Village
Photo: Odejea,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Les Orres is a commune in the Hautes-Alpes department in southeastern France. It is chiefly known for its ski resort: 38 alpine skiing runs, 100 km of runs. Les Orres is situated 6 km northwest of Cabane de la Rama.
